Talent.com
Embedded Development Engineer

Embedded Development Engineer

Cohere Technology Group LLCHerndon, VA, US
30+ days ago
Job type
  • Full-time
Job description

Job Description

Job Description

Cohere is looking for software engineers with C / C++ and assembly skills, hands-on knowledge of operating system internals including writing device drivers for current, new, and emerging hardware products centered on the ARM, Intel, and Risc-V processors. You will be working with cutting-edge designs and will be encouraged to dream up unique and elegant solutions as a part of a highly motivated and productive professional team. Any hardware, kernel, knowledge and reverse engineering of low-level CPU and system aspects is a plus.

Clearance :

No clearance is required. However, we seek individuals that have an appropriate background for obtaining a high-level security clearance.

The Role

This position is for an Embedded Systems Software Developer position. Applicants should have an understanding of kernels, micro-kernels, and / or RTOS internals, including using OS APIs and security boundaries available in the hardware. As an Embedded Systems Software Developer, you develop capabilities in support of operations. Your primary focus will be developing tools and applications that work in both user and kernel space. You will play a crucial role in developing custom capabilities used on live systems especially focused on protecting system. You will be a key player supporting national security interests.

Requirements and Skills :

When assessing candidates for the Embedded Systems Software Developer position, Cohere is looking for candidates with the following knowledge, skills, and abilities :

Software  – Candidates should be able to demonstrate extensive experience coding in C / C++ and Python, including understanding Object Oriented Programming, Networking (sockets), Multithreading, and implementing cryptographic protocols for data at rest and data in transit. You should be capable of developing technical solutions to complex problems.

Hardware  – You should have some understanding of how operating systems use and leverage hardware protection capabilities and how to use these to prevent a wide range of cyber attack techniques, including stack and heap attacks such as buffer overflows, off by one vulnerabilities, memory leaks, and format string attacks. Any additional understanding in how attackers bypass protections like stack canaries, DEP, K / ASLR, CFG, KPP, SMEP / SMAP is a plus.

Reverse Engineering  – Any experience using RE tools including both debuggers and disassemblers and / or abilities creating code generation automation tools is also useful.

Creative Thinking  – as Operating Systems and Hardware evolve, tools that worked before probably will need improvements in the future. Migrating software quickly to new Hardware platforms will require beyond-the-norm abilities. We need team members who are driven to learn and excited about solving hard problems and who can adapt to changing environments.

Communication  – Just as important as your technical skills, as a Subject Matter Expert, you are expected to advise and assist the other teammates. This requires being able to clearly break down and explain complex techniques to others.

Collaboration  – You should know how to use a version control system and CI / CD tools, preferably git or gitlab.

Leadership  – You may function in a project leadership role, and you should be comfortable leading small teams.

Interested in working in this space, but don’t feel you meet all the qualifications? Reach out anyway. Cohere is willing to mentor and develop promising candidates, ensuring they have the skills and abilities necessary to excel.

Compensation :

Cohere knows that our employees are our most valuable assets. Cohere offers competitive pay, commensurate with experience, labor categories, and current market demands.

FULLY PAID health care premiums for medical with PPO and HSA options

FULLY PAID dental, vision, and life insurance

Earn 240 hours PTO / year (30 days, accrued at 20 hours / month)

401k plan with matching employer contributions and profit sharing

Extremely lucrative referral programs

Monthly billable incentive rewards

Yearly training allowance for self-development

Flexible schedules

About Cohere :

Cohere was founded in 2015 by seasoned intelligence community engineers to unify and streamline both cyber and kinetic workflows for the Intelligence Community and the Department of Defense.

We are looking for candidates to join our team as we grow our cyber development department. This is an opportunity to join a close-knit team of engineers who are passionate about learning from each other and developing next-generation capabilities supporting our stakeholders’ operations. Your work will contribute directly to securing infrastructure from malicious cyber actors.

We invest in our people, offering tailored training and mentorship as we grow our engineers. We believe that providing opportunities to learn fuels individual and organizational success. At Cohere, not only will you take your technical skills to the next level, but if desired, you can learn the processes and skills necessary to launch your own company too. We offer mentoring opportunities to learn from experienced leaders on creating and growing your own contracting business.

If you have a background in coding and computer security and want to take your career to the next level, with the ability to learn from senior engineers invested in your success, apply today!

Powered by JazzHR

myscerOUsP

Create a job alert for this search

Embedded Engineer • Herndon, VA, US

Related jobs
Embedded Development Engineer

Embedded Development Engineer

Cohere Technology Group LLCHerndon, VA, US
Full-time
Quick Apply
Cohere is looking for software engineers with C / C++ and assembly skills, hands-on knowledge of operating system internals including writing device drivers for current, new, and emerging hardware pr...Show moreLast updated: 30+ days ago
  • Promoted
Sr. Product Manager - Embedded Payments

Sr. Product Manager - Embedded Payments

WEXWashington, DC, United States
Full-time
This is a remote position, however, the candidate must reside within 30 miles of one of the following locations : Portland ME, Chicago IL, Boston MA, Washington DC, Dallas TX, San Jose CA, Seattle W...Show moreLast updated: 30+ days ago
Sr. Embedded Software Engineer-RF & communications Systems (SDR)

Sr. Embedded Software Engineer-RF & communications Systems (SDR)

SecmationWashington DC Metro, DC, USA
Full-time
Quick Apply
Software Defined Radio Development Engineer.Position Type : Full-Time | Hybrid.Relocation assistance (if applicable).Join the Future of Secure Embedded Communications. Secmation is looking for a Seni...Show moreLast updated: 15 days ago
Embedded Software Engineer - AV Safety

Embedded Software Engineer - AV Safety

ForterraClarksburg, Maryland, United States, 20871
Full-time
Forterra is a leading provider of autonomous systems for ground-based movement in the working world.Amongst some of the earliest innovators in the field of driverless technology, Forterra is focuse...Show moreLast updated: 30+ days ago
  • Promoted
Product Owner (Hybrid) - 25867

Product Owner (Hybrid) - 25867

EnlightenColumbia, Maryland, US
Full-time
Enlighten, honored as a Top Workplace from USA Today, is a leader in big data solution development and deployment, with expertise in cloud-based services, software and systems engineering, cyber ca...Show moreLast updated: 1 day ago
  • Promoted
Senior Embedded Software Engineer

Senior Embedded Software Engineer

STRArlington, VA, US
Full-time
The Systems Development Division (SDD) delivers technology advantage into users' hands by delivering capabilities focused on end-customer needs that function in operationally relevant environme...Show moreLast updated: 30+ days ago
  • Promoted
Platform Engineer (Hybrid) - 22190

Platform Engineer (Hybrid) - 22190

EnlightenColumbia, Maryland, US
Full-time
Enlighten, honored as a Top Workplace from USA Today, is a leader in big data solution development and deployment, with expertise in cloud-based services, software and systems engineering, cyber ca...Show moreLast updated: 30+ days ago
  • Promoted
Software Engineer (Hybrid) - 25880

Software Engineer (Hybrid) - 25880

EnlightenColumbia, Maryland, US
Full-time
Enlighten, honored as a Top Workplace from USA Today, is a leader in big data solution development and deployment, with expertise in cloud-based services, software and systems engineering, cyber ca...Show moreLast updated: 2 days ago
  • Promoted
Software Engineer, Embedded Systems

Software Engineer, Embedded Systems

ValinorWashington, DC, US
Full-time
There are too many problems that are unaddressed in the resiliency ecosystem.These problems, while quiet, are significant. and left unsolved they create gaps that widen until systems crack and miss...Show moreLast updated: 13 days ago
  • Promoted
Senior Systems Engineer - Tomahawk Weapons System

Senior Systems Engineer - Tomahawk Weapons System

SimVentions, Inc - Glassdoor 4.6Bealeton, VA, US
Full-time
SimVentions is 100% employee-owned and has consistently been voted one of Virginia's Best Places to Work! We are looking for a Senior Systems Engineer to serve alongside a high-functioning team of ...Show moreLast updated: 2 days ago
  • Promoted
Principal Software Development Engineer

Principal Software Development Engineer

Hispanic Alliance for Career EnhancementWashington, DC, United States
Full-time
At CVS Health, we're building a world of health around every consumer and surrounding ourselves with dedicated colleagues who are passionate about transforming health care.As the nation's leading h...Show moreLast updated: 18 days ago
  • Promoted
Senior Embedded Engineer Sterling, Virginia, United States

Senior Embedded Engineer Sterling, Virginia, United States

DedroneWashington, DC, United States
Full-time
Dedrone is the world’s most trusted smart airspace security company.Hundreds of commercial, government and military customers around the world rely on Dedrone’s comprehensive, command and control (...Show moreLast updated: 30+ days ago
  • Promoted
Regional Engineer

Regional Engineer

Lane Enterprises IncBealeton, VA, US
Full-time
We are excited to welcome a Regional Engineer to our team! From.Employee Stock Ownership Plan (ESOP).Medical, Dental, Vision, 401k, Paid Time Off, Paid Holidays, Flexible Spending, Company paid Lif...Show moreLast updated: 30+ days ago
  • Promoted
Platform Engineer (Hybrid) - 25120

Platform Engineer (Hybrid) - 25120

EnlightenColumbia, Maryland, US
Full-time
Enlighten, honored as a Top Workplace from USA Today, is a leader in big data solution development and deployment, with expertise in cloud-based services, software and systems engineering, cyber ca...Show moreLast updated: 30+ days ago
  • Promoted
Embedded AI Solutions Engineer

Embedded AI Solutions Engineer

KnexusVienna, VA, US
Full-time
The Embedded AI Solutions Engineer will be a key liaison between Knexus' technical development teams and our government partners, specifically at DLA HQ in Ft. This role is responsible for the f...Show moreLast updated: 30+ days ago
  • Promoted
Sales Development Representative

Sales Development Representative

Vertosoft LLCLeesburg, VA, US
Full-time
To keep up with the growing market demand, Vertosoft is seeking a hard-working, business-minded, personable team player to join our Government Sales team as a Sales Development Representative.At Ve...Show moreLast updated: 27 days ago
  • Promoted
Retail Merchandise Processor Full Time

Retail Merchandise Processor Full Time

Goodwill Monocacy ValleyMiddletown, MD, US
Full-time
East Main Street Middletown Maryland, 21769, +1 (240) 6518994.Works as a member of the store team to lead an excellent customer and brand experience, and promote sales. Responsible for processing re...Show moreLast updated: 1 day ago
  • Promoted
Manager, Engineering

Manager, Engineering

VB SpineLeesburg, VA, US
Full-time
Allendale, NJ or Leesburg, VA (Hybrid with ~30% travel).At VB Spine, we're committed to advancing spinal surgery through innovative solutions that improve patient outcomes.We're looking for a Manag...Show moreLast updated: 6 days ago